What does Samuka mean?
[ syll. sa-mu-ka, sam-uka ] The baby boy name Samuka is pronounced as SAEMUHKAH †. The origin of Samuka is the Hebrew language. Samuka is a variation of the name Samuel (English, French, German, and Hebrew).
See also the related category hebrew.
Samuka is not commonly used as a baby boy name. It is not listed within the top 1000. In 2018, out of the family of boy names directly related to Samuka, Samuel was the most popular.
